    I have PD10 (but the same was the case with 10.6.8 and 9) with two VMs - XPSP3 and Vista (I know...). Anyway, I can connect to the internet thru Parallels just fine, but cannot thru XP!

    When I look at "Network Connections" in the Control Panel, it lists
    Name: "Local Area Connection"
    Type: "LAN or High-Speed Internet"
    Status: "Network cable unplugged"
    Device Name: "Parallels Ethernet Adapter"
    Phone # or Host Address: (null/blank)
    Owner: "System"

    What's odd is that I'm using a wireless router. And, as I say, in Vista I have no problems connecting thru Parallels...

    When I do an XP Network Diagnostics scan, there are NO Network Adapters listed!

    (Just for smiles, I have another Mac running Parallels 7, with XPSP3 as well, and it connects fine, and can find the Network Adapter just fine.)

    Btw, the most promising is the step from KB with network stack reset:

    netsh winsock reset
    netsh int ip reset reset.log
